After a break of a couple of chapters, the Pharisees are back attacking Jesus. Remember that the Pharisees were legalists, not just demanding obedience to the 10 commandments, but to 613 rules mostly made up by men. One of the rules had to do with washing of hands before the meal. According to the Pharisees, it was a SIN to eat with unwashed hands, not simply a matter of bad hygiene.
Jesus confronts them with a passage out of Isaiah. The problem with legalism is that religion is no longer a based upon that faith relationship with God, but it becomes about obeying the rules. The more the focus is placed on the rules, the less and less it is focused on our relationship with our Living God.
Who is this Jesus? One who wants us to have a relationship with us based upon our trust in Him, and not our saying the right words or doing the right things.
